Βίντεο: Τι είναι η τοπική βάση δεδομένων στο MongoDB;
2024 Συγγραφέας: Lynn Donovan | [email protected]. Τελευταία τροποποίηση: 2023-12-15 23:45
ΣΦΑΙΡΙΚΗ ΕΙΚΟΝΑ. Κάθε μογγολατρική περίπτωση έχει τη δική της τοπική βάση δεδομένων , το οποίο αποθηκεύει δεδομένα που χρησιμοποιούνται στη διαδικασία αναπαραγωγής και άλλα δεδομένα για συγκεκριμένες περιπτώσεις. ο τοπική βάση δεδομένων είναι αόρατο στην αναπαραγωγή: συλλογές στο τοπική βάση δεδομένων δεν αναπαράγονται.
Εξάλλου, είναι τοπική βάση δεδομένων MongoDB;
ΣΦΑΙΡΙΚΗ ΕΙΚΟΝΑ. Κάθε μογγολατρική περίπτωση έχει τη δική της τοπική βάση δεδομένων , το οποίο αποθηκεύει δεδομένα που χρησιμοποιούνται στη διαδικασία αναπαραγωγής και άλλα δεδομένα για συγκεκριμένες περιπτώσεις. ο τοπική βάση δεδομένων είναι αόρατο στην αναπαραγωγή: συλλογές στο τοπική βάση δεδομένων δεν αναπαράγονται.
Δεύτερον, μπορώ να χρησιμοποιήσω το MongoDB τοπικά; Χρησιμοποιώντας ένα τοπικός παράδειγμα του MongoDB είναι μια πολύ απλή διαδικασία. Εμείς θα χρησιμοποιήσω mongooseJS, το πακέτο Node για εργασία MongoDB . Εμείς θα επίσης να δώσει μαγκούστα ένα όνομα βάσης δεδομένων για σύνδεση (δεν χρειάζεται να δημιουργηθεί από τότε μαγκούστα θα δημιουργήστε το για εμάς). Ακολουθεί ένα δείγμα κώδικα για σύνδεση σε μια βάση δεδομένων στο Node.
Ως εκ τούτου, τι είναι μια τοπική βάση δεδομένων;
ΕΝΑ τοπική βάση δεδομένων είναι ένα που είναι τοπικός μόνο στην αίτησή σας. Χρησιμοποιεί ένα αρχείο δεδομένων SDF, το οποίο είναι μορφή SQL Server CE (Compact Edition). Δεν χρειάζεται να εγκαταστήσετε διακομιστή για πρόσβαση σε SDF βάση δεδομένων . Απλώς διανέμετε τα DLL που αποτελούν το SSCE μαζί με την εφαρμογή σας και αποκτάτε απευθείας πρόσβαση στο αρχείο δεδομένων.
Πώς συνδέεται το MongoDB με τη βάση δεδομένων;
Προς το συνδέω-συωδεομαι στο τοπικό σας MongoDB , ορίζετε το όνομα κεντρικού υπολογιστή σε localhost και το Port σε 27017. Αυτές οι τιμές είναι οι προεπιλογές για όλα τα τοπικά Συνδέσεις MongoDB (εκτός αν τα άλλαξες). Τύπος συνδέω-συωδεομαι , και θα πρέπει να δείτε το βάσεις δεδομένων στο τοπικό σας MongoDB.
Συνιστάται:
Γιατί μια επίπεδη βάση δεδομένων είναι λιγότερο αποτελεσματική από μια σχεσιακή βάση δεδομένων;
Ένας ενιαίος πίνακας με επίπεδο αρχείο είναι χρήσιμος για την καταγραφή περιορισμένου όγκου δεδομένων. Αλλά μια μεγάλη βάση δεδομένων με επίπεδο αρχείου μπορεί να είναι αναποτελεσματική καθώς καταλαμβάνει περισσότερο χώρο και μνήμη από μια σχεσιακή βάση δεδομένων. Απαιτεί επίσης την προσθήκη νέων δεδομένων κάθε φορά που εισάγετε μια νέα εγγραφή, ενώ μια σχεσιακή βάση δεδομένων όχι
Πώς μπορώ να επαναφέρω μια βάση δεδομένων SQL σε άλλη βάση δεδομένων;
Για να επαναφέρετε μια βάση δεδομένων σε μια νέα θέση και προαιρετικά να μετονομάσετε τη βάση δεδομένων. Συνδεθείτε στην κατάλληλη παρουσία του SQL Server Database Engine και, στη συνέχεια, στην Εξερεύνηση αντικειμένων, κάντε κλικ στο όνομα διακομιστή για να αναπτύξετε το δέντρο διακομιστή. Κάντε δεξί κλικ στο Databases και, στη συνέχεια, κάντε κλικ στο Restore Database. Ανοίγει το παράθυρο διαλόγου Επαναφορά βάσης δεδομένων
Πώς μπορώ να επαναφέρω μια βάση δεδομένων σε διαφορετική βάση δεδομένων;
Για να επαναφέρετε μια βάση δεδομένων σε μια νέα θέση και προαιρετικά να μετονομάσετε τη βάση δεδομένων Συνδεθείτε στην κατάλληλη παρουσία του μηχανισμού βάσης δεδομένων SQL Server και, στη συνέχεια, στην Εξερεύνηση αντικειμένων, κάντε κλικ στο όνομα διακομιστή για να αναπτύξετε το δέντρο διακομιστή. Κάντε δεξί κλικ στο Databases και, στη συνέχεια, κάντε κλικ στο Restore Database
Πώς μπορώ να επαναφέρω την τοπική μου βάση δεδομένων Azure;
Για να επαναφέρετε γεωγραφικά μια μεμονωμένη βάση δεδομένων SQL από την πύλη Azure στην περιοχή και τον διακομιστή της επιλογής σας, ακολουθήστε τα εξής βήματα: Από τον Πίνακα ελέγχου, επιλέξτε Προσθήκη > Δημιουργία βάσης δεδομένων SQL. Επιλέξτε Πρόσθετες ρυθμίσεις. Για Χρήση υπαρχόντων δεδομένων, επιλέξτε Δημιουργία αντιγράφων ασφαλείας. Για τη δημιουργία αντιγράφων ασφαλείας, επιλέξτε ένα αντίγραφο ασφαλείας από τη λίστα των διαθέσιμων αντιγράφων ασφαλείας γεωγραφικής επαναφοράς
Πώς μπορώ να δημιουργήσω μια νέα βάση δεδομένων από μια υπάρχουσα βάση δεδομένων του SQL Server;
Στην Εξερεύνηση αντικειμένων του SQL Server, στον κόμβο SQL Server, αναπτύξτε την παρουσία του συνδεδεμένου διακομιστή σας. Κάντε δεξί κλικ στον κόμβο Βάσεις δεδομένων και επιλέξτε Προσθήκη νέας βάσης δεδομένων. Μετονομάστε τη νέα βάση δεδομένων σε TradeDev. Κάντε δεξί κλικ στη βάση δεδομένων Trade στον SQL Server Object Explorer και επιλέξτε Σύγκριση σχήματος